That’s the imaginative and prescient of the Ethereum Interop Layer (EIL): making Ethereum really feel like one chain once more — whereas preserving the trust-minimized, decentralized foundations all of us care about.
EIL makes Ethereum’s rollups really feel like a single, unified chain by enabling customers to signal as soon as for a cross-chain transaction with out including new belief assumptions. Constructed on ERC-4337 account abstraction and the rules of the Trustless Manifesto, customers themselves provoke and settle cross-L2 actions instantly from their wallets, not by relayers or solvers. EIL preserves Ethereum’s core ensures of self-custody, censorship resistance, disintermediation, and verifiable onchain execution. This new account-based interoperability layer unifies Ethereum’s fragmented L2 ecosystem underneath Ethereum’s personal safety mannequin.
The issue: fragmentation at scale
L2 chains have introduced dramatic positive aspects in throughput and cost-efficiency. But they’ve launched a brand new sort of complexity for customers and wallets:
- Which chain is my token on?
- How do I transfer tokens from Arbitrum → Base → Scroll → Linea?
- Do I have to belief a third-party bridge or relayer?
- Does my pockets or dapp have to manually combine each new chain?
From a person’s perspective, the result’s much less Ethereum and extra a number of separate Ethereums. You’re managing chains, not merely transacting. That creates friction, cognitive overhead, and sometimes publicity to further belief assumptions — bridges, relayers, solvers — together with elevated censorship threat.

What it takes: belief assumptions, preserved
Unity of UX is compelling — however provided that it doesn’t compromise Ethereum’s core values:
- Self-custody: customers maintain their belongings and provoke transactions themselves.
- Censorship-resistance: no middleman can block or delay your transaction.
- Privateness: you don’t need to reveal your IP deal with or intentions to a relayer or solver.
- Verifiability: any logic that issues might be checked onchain or in open-source pockets code.
EIL was designed in accordance with the trustless manifesto. It strikes the logic onchain and into the person’s pockets, eradicating dependence on intermediaries and opaque server logic. Customers transact instantly on all chains; trustless liquidity suppliers provide funds however by no means work together instantly with customers, nor see their transactions.
As an alternative of “I belief a bridge operator to maneuver my funds,” you get “my pockets and contract do it — underneath verifiable guidelines.”
The belief boundary stays minimal.

From the person’s view: the way it feels
-
Cross-chain switch — Alice has USDC on Arbitrum, Bob is on Base.
In a single click on, her pockets executes a switch to Bob’s Base deal with. From Alice’s viewpoint: “Ship USDC to Bob” — she doesn’t care which community it occurs on. -
Cross-chain mint — Alice holds ETH on Arbitrum and Scroll. She desires to mint an NFT on Linea.
Her pockets routinely consolidates balances and handles inter-chain gasoline and asset motion transparently. One click on, one signature. -
Cross-chain swap — Alice finds higher liquidity for her token on an Optimism DEX.
She swaps from Arbitrum, her pockets handles the trail, and he or she finally ends up again on Arbitrum along with her new token — no bridging, no guide steps.
For the person it’s: “Ship, mint, swap — I simply do what I would like.”
Behind the scenes it’s: “Pockets + onchain protocol transact throughout chains — no new belief necessities.”
